HULL CITY: Brown - confidence is returning
Brown was in Atalanta to see Richard Garcia score twice in the 2-2 draw with the Italian Serie A side last night.
And he believes the performance in Italy is evidence that as the pressure releases off his players, the better they are getting.
Asked about the effects of the Stoke victory he said: "I think less pressure but more confidence where the players are concerned.
"When you ask the players to play football you have to play with confidence and here we have seen a little more confidence.
"Hopefully we can carry that into the West Ham game."
Garcia equalised twice for City but Bernard Mendy, Andy Dawson and George Boateng all missed after the game went to spot-kicks.
Brown added: "I thought it was a very good game. Both sides have injuries and international players away.
"A lot of young players had a look at the game and I thought it was very entertaining – two very good goals from Atalanta and two very good goals from us."
